Four reasons for the poor dispersion of the coating in the production of acid copper plating brightener

Tue Dec 06 13:43:10 CST 2022

    In the production process of using acid copper plating brightener, the dispersion ability of workpiece coating is relatively poor, and the thickness difference between high and low areas is relatively large. What causes this?

    According to the field experience and the characteristics of the product acid copper plating brightener Cu-510, Bigolly Technology has made analysis, mainly for the following four reasons:

    1. If the concentration of copper sulfate in the bath is too high or too low, the conductivity of the bath will be poor, the coating will be rough, the anode will be easily passivated, and the dispersion of the coating will be poor.Therefore, in the production process, the concentration of each component of the plating solution should be analyzed and controlled within the process range.

    2. The temperature of the plating solution is relatively high.During production, the bath temperature shall be controlled within 20~45 ℃.Although higher temperature can improve the conductivity of the plating solution, the crystallization of the coating is relatively rough and the dislocation is relatively poor.

    3. The leveller or brightener in the plating solution is insufficient.The leveller Cu-510A can improve the brightness and leveling effect of the low area of the coating. When Cu-510A is insufficient, the displacement effect of the coating is poor, and the phenomenon of bright fault will occur.The brightener Cu-510B is used to provide grain refinement, improve low area dispersion and wettability, and provide high and middle area brightness leveling effect. When Cu-510B is insufficient, the coating is poor in brightness leveling, roughness and dislocation.

    4. The content of organic impurities in the plating solution is high.With the progress of production, the decomposition products of additives or grease are continuously accumulated in the plating solution.When the content of these organic impurities is high, the brittleness of the coating will be greater, the displacement effect will become worse, and the brightness will also become worse.
